From 8491ac1341ad9e993c510d4914f3473c1aedb85a Mon Sep 17 00:00:00 2001 From: Shahriar Date: Thu, 23 May 2019 15:24:24 +0430 Subject: [PATCH] v2.1 (#55) * Update README * Add Theme * deprecated items * Add VM Classes * Rm Dotnet Core Test * Add LoggerLib * Add UnitTest * Clean Code * Use Logger * Rename Source Folder for clarification * Update README * Oops :) * RM old keys * Rm OldUnitTestProj * UI Changes * Resharper suggestions * Add ui concepts And Little ui changes * ui update * ui improvements * improv Login + Singlton PocketHandler + Cleaning a bit * Update UiUtil * VM in MainPage * VM in MainPage * Half VM for MainContent * New navview (#45) * Fix Login Theme * VM MainContent with Controls * Rm MainPage * TagsList Ctrl * ArticleList Ctrl * Fix ImageDialog * Update Screenshots * Fix All ListViews * Bug fixes related to Themes * Fix Minor Problems * Encapsulate InAppNotification * Fix InAppNotif UI * Fix WhiteTheme * Rm UserInfo from Settings * Improve binding * Fix Minor UI Bugs * UPdate README * Rm TagListCtrl * little ui changes * Fix WebViewBtn on Error Page (Issue #53) * UpdateGitIgnore * Minor fixes * If there is no tag, get center * Fix Caching the List * Making sure first remove cache then Delete it from server - in case of exceptions * Better tag loading * Cache User Info * Add UserStatistics --- .gitignore | 1 + Source/PocketX/Controls/MarkdownControl.xaml | 14 +- .../PocketX/Controls/MarkdownControl.xaml.cs | 4 + .../Converter/ArrayToStringConverter.cs | 13 ++ .../PocketX/Converter/HideIfEmptyConverter.cs | 16 ++ Source/PocketX/Handlers/PocketHandler.cs | 171 ++++++++++-------- Source/PocketX/Package.StoreAssociation.xml | 49 ++++- Source/PocketX/Package.appxmanifest | 9 +- Source/PocketX/PocketX.csproj | 12 +- .../ViewModels/MainContentViewModel.cs | 2 + .../PocketX/Views/Dialog/SettingsDialog.xaml | 105 ++++++++--- .../Views/Dialog/SettingsDialog.xaml.cs | 14 +- Source/PocketX/Views/MainContent.xaml | 29 +-- Source/PocketX/Views/MainContent.xaml.cs | 4 + 14 files changed, 298 insertions(+), 145 deletions(-) create mode 100644 Source/PocketX/Converter/ArrayToStringConverter.cs create mode 100644 Source/PocketX/Converter/HideIfEmptyConverter.cs diff --git a/.gitignore b/.gitignore index 51de314..3746275 100644 --- a/.gitignore +++ b/.gitignore @@ -1 +1,2 @@ +Source/PocketX/Package.StoreAssociation.xml Source/PocketX/Handlers/Keys.cs \ No newline at end of file diff --git a/Source/PocketX/Controls/MarkdownControl.xaml b/Source/PocketX/Controls/MarkdownControl.xaml index 2895d84..9c01c76 100644 --- a/Source/PocketX/Controls/MarkdownControl.xaml +++ b/Source/PocketX/Controls/MarkdownControl.xaml @@ -7,7 +7,6 @@ xmlns:mc="http://schemas.openxmlformats.org/markup-compatibility/2006" xmlns:controls="using:Microsoft.Toolkit.Uwp.UI.Controls" xmlns:converter="using:PocketX.Converter" - Background="{x:Bind Settings.ReaderBg,Mode=OneWay}" RequestedTheme="{x:Bind Settings.ReaderTheme,Mode=OneWay}" mc:Ignorable="d"> @@ -82,8 +81,7 @@ VerticalAlignment="Center" />